ILADD to Celebrate Completion of Crossbridge Point Homes on July 29
Community Invited to Celebrate Historic Milestone for Adults with Intellectual and Developmental Disabilities
ZIONSVILLE, Ind. – ILADD, Inc. (Independent Living for Adults with
Developmental/Intellectual Disabilities) invites the community to celebrate the
completion of Crossbridge Point, a unique neighborhood within Wild Air in Zionsville
designed to provide homeownership opportunities for adults with intellectual and
developmental disabilities who wish to live as independently as possible in a supportive,
welcoming community.
The public celebration will take place on Wednesday, July 29, 2026, at 5:30 p.m. at
Crossbridge Point in Zionsville. Community members, supporters, partners, and families
are invited to attend as ILADD recognizes the completion of the neighborhood’s first
homes and celebrates the vision that has become a reality.
Crossbridge Point includes 17 homes created specifically for ILADD
self-advocates—adults with intellectual and developmental disabilities who desire to live
independently. One of the homes, the ILADD Learning Home, is owned by ILADD to
host independent living skills classes and assessments and other activities for all
self-advocates that ILADD serves. The neighborhood represents years of planning,
collaboration, and community investment while providing families with peace of mind
knowing their loved ones have a safe, stable place to call home.
“Crossbridge Point is about dignity, choice, belonging, and independence,” said Andy
Kirby, Executive Director of ILADD. “Our self-advocates want the same opportunities
as everyone else—to live in a home of their own, be part of a neighborhood, and build
meaningful relationships with neighbors and friends. This celebration marks the
beginning of a new chapter for the individuals and families ILADD serves.”
Crossbridge Point has been made possible through a partnership with Old Town
Companies, the neighborhood’s developer and builder. Old Town’s commitment to
supporting adults with intellectual and developmental disabilities through thoughtful,community-focused development has been instrumental in bringing this innovative
housing model to life.
Capital Campaign Nears Completion
The celebration also highlights the beginning of the final phase of ILADD’s Bridges to
Independence Capital Campaign. The campaign has already achieved over 80% of its
$3.2 million goal for the building and maintenance of the ILADD Learning Home, Activity
Center, and other features of Crossbridge Point. The Activity Center, to be completed in
mid-2027, will serve as the heart of the neighborhood, providing space for life skills
education, health and wellness programming, social gatherings, and inclusive
community events.

About ILADD
ILADD (Independent Living for Adults with Developmental/Intellectual Disabilities), a
nonprofit based in Zionsville, Indiana, empowers adults with intellectual and
developmental disabilities by providing housing opportunities, lifelong learning, and
enrichment programming, and social options that create meaningful community
engagement. Through innovative programs and partnerships, ILADD helps over 200
adults with intellectual and developmental disabilities from five different central Indiana
counties build confidence, independence, and lasting connections while creating
pathways to lives filled with purpose and belonging.
